FAQ:
Q: What is the function of the accumulator charging valve?
A: The function of the Accumulator Charging Valve is to control the charging of the accumulator within a preset switching range. There are integrations of a pilot stage with defined hysteresis, a main piston, and a check valve into the circuit. Therefore, the charge of the accumulator happens at port A from pump port P across the check valve.
Q: Where are Mico single accumulator charging valves installed?
A: These MICO® Single Accumulator Charging Valves are designed for installation in an open-center hydraulic system between the pump and its relief valve and the downstream secondary hydraulic devices; for example, a power steering control valve and cylinder installed in the same hydraulic circuit.
Q: Where does the charge of the accumulator occur?
A: Therefore, the charge of the accumulator happens at port A from pump port P across the check valve. Indeed, if the pressure in the accumulator exceeds the pre-set value of the pilot stage, the main piston opens. Then, relieved of the pump to the tank happens.
Q: Why do you need a HYDAC hydro accumulator charging valve?
A: As a result of the combination of HYDAC hydro-accumulator and HYDAC accumulator charging valve, pumps and motors on oil-hydraulics plants with fluctuating flow rate requirements can be dimensioned smaller. This saves on both costs and energy – unnecessary heat generation is thus avoided.
